Salida is the county seat of Chaffee County and its largest city, with a population of 5,504 in 2000. The city is the service, supply, and tourism center for the Upper Arkansas Valley. The 2001-02 survey of historic buildings in Salida had two primary goals: to conduct an intensive level survey to record and evaluate properties within and adjacent to the historic commercial district and to conduct a reconnaissance level survey of the remainder of...

In 1996, a rare book expert is offered the job of a lifetime: analysis and conservation of a mysterious, beautifully illuminated Hebrew manuscript created in fifteenth-century Spain and recently saved from destruction during the shelling of Sarajevo's libraries. When Hanna Heath, a caustic Aussie loner with a passion for her work, discovers a series of tiny artifacts in the book's ancient binding - an insect-wing fragment, wine stains, salt crystals,...

Reopens the unsolved mystery of the most catastrophic library fire in American history, the 1986 Los Angeles Public Library fire, while exploring the crucial role that libraries play in modern American culture
